Govt procured 17,497 MT Kharif paddy with enhance rate, Sushanta

In order to double the income of farmers, the paddy procurement programme under Kharif season at the minimum support price (MSP) at Rs 23, the state government has procured a total of 17,497.109 metric tons from farmers.
Addressing a press conference at Civil Secretariat on Tuesday afternoon, Food and Civil Supplies Minister Sushanta Chowdhury said that altogether 8922 farmers of the state get benefit of MSP and a total of Rs. 40.25 crore has utilized and so far Rs. 35.52 crore of amount have already been disbursed directly to farmers.
In the interests of the farmers, this time the minimum support price (MSP) has been increased by Rs 23 per kg. Hence, the paddy has been lifted at an enhanced minimum support price (MSP) of Rs. 2,300 per quintal instead of last season’s Rs 2,183 per quintal from the farmers at 51 (Forty-nine) designated paddy procurement places (PPC) across 19 subdivisions of the state, said Sushanta Chowdhury.
Given the price hike in every sector, the farmers are getting an increased MSP at Rs 1.17 per kg at Rs2,300 per quintal in place of the Rs 2,183 MSP paid last time. This increased price has been handed over through online mode into farmers bank accounts without making commitments to the middlemen and is also proving to help earn more to their labor, said the Minister.
The entire range of paddy procurement operations is carried out by the Department of Food in collaboration with the Department of Agriculture and Farmers Welfare with financial support from the Food Corporation of India (FCI). In all the 51 PPCs, farmers of the state sell their quality paddy at the enhanced MSP, said the Minister and added that remaining 12% amount of paddy procurement will be disbursed soon.
He said that the paddy procurement has been started from designated centres on December 19, 2024 last and has been continued up to February 8th, 2025.
Chowdhury said that after the formation of BJP government in Tripura, the procurement of paddy from farmers of the state with MSP has been started twice in a year for doubling the farmer’s income and in the last ‘Ravi’ and ‘Kharif’ seasons, the government from 2018-19 to till date, the state government has procured 2, 25,356.805 metric tons of paddy directly from 1,17,049 farmers and government has utilized a sum of Rs. 446.13 crore.
The paddy procurement in 2018-19 has been started with Rs. 17.50 per kg of MSP and in the present financial year, it has been increased at Rs. 23 per kg.
